A leading environmental consultancy is looking for Archaeology candidates to join their team based in Basingstoke. Successful candidates will engage in a variety of site-based work across the Southeast of England, with immediate start available for six-month full-time fixed term contracts. Opportunities for skill development and further projects may arise, providing experience in both office and site settings.
